DESCRIPTION:Maximilian Messmer (Technische Universität Dresden\, D)\nLase
 r WakeField Acceleration (LWFA) has emerged as a promising concept in an e
 ffort to build compact\, multi GeV electron accelerators. This plasma base
 d accelerator technique uses laser induced charge carrier density waves to
  create extreme accelerating field gradients.  To attain highest possible
  particle energies\, a high energy laser must be focused over distances mu
 ch greater than the Rayleigh length. As part of my master thesis\, the gui
 dance of terra watt laser beams has been experimentally shown for distance
 s in capillary discharge plasma waveguides.\nThe talk will briefly explain
  the concept of laser wakefield acceleration and laser guiding in plasma c
 hannels\, followed by the experimental results of laser guiding experiment
 s conducted at the Helmholz Zentrum Dresden Rossendorf (HZDR).
